Alla Pugacheva left Russia with her children at the end of September, and the press continues to report more and more about her departure. According to the Ukrainian edition of Telegraf, the singer received Israeli citizenship in May of this year. Even a passport photo with Pugacheva’s data was published on the resource’s website – but it is impossible to establish the authenticity of the document.

Presumably, the validity of the passport issued to the artist is one year. As News.ru explains, this practice applies to those returning to the new country. Neither the celebrity nor their representatives have confirmed the news of obtaining foreign citizenship.

According to media reports, Alla Borisovna flew to Israel the other day with her daughter Lisa and son Harry. It is reported that the family flew from the capital’s Vnukovo airport without a return ticket. According to journalists, in Israel there is the husband of singer Maxim Galkin *, who in September was entered into the register of individuals-foreign agents by the Ministry of Justice.

Pugacheva and Galkin* left Russia in March, shortly after the start of military special operations in Ukraine. The couple lived with their children, first in Israel and then in Latvia. But the singer denied the rumors of emigration and promised to return to Russia, which he did in early autumn. But he did not stay long in Moscow.

The authors of the telegram channel Mash suggest that Alla Borisovna returned to her homeland to sell real estate and get things done. According to them, he put up for sale his mansion in the village of Gryaz near Moscow for 1 billion rubles and took the children’s documents from the school.

Since February, Galkin * has more than once criticized the decisions of the Russian authorities, Pugacheva was silent for a long time, but for the first time in mid-September spoke out in solidarity with her husband. After that, information emerged that it might happen. verify To discredit the Russian army.

The other day, the singer spoke again on Instagram ** and harshly responded to haters who criticized her for her departure. On behalf of the Veterans of Russia movement, it was learned that a statement was written to Pugacheva demanding that she be checked for money laundering and incitement to hatred and enmity.
